The $23 Billion Problem: Wasted Vertical Space

The International Warehouse Logistics Association reveals a startling gap: while average warehouse heights reach 11 meters, 40% of facilities utilize only 6 meters effectively. This vertical underutilization directly correlates with a 23% spike in operational costs for mid-sized manufacturers. Traditional pallet racks, limited by static load capacities and fixed configurations, simply can't adapt to modern SKU variability.

Root Causes: Beyond Simple Design Flaws

Three technical barriers perpetuate this crisis:

  • Dynamic weight distribution failures in multi-tier systems
  • Incompatibility with automated retrieval systems (ARS)
  • Thermal expansion vulnerabilities in alloy frameworks

The 2023 Materials Handling Institute report highlights how industrial-grade vertical storage systems with IoT-enabled strain sensors reduced racking failures by 41% compared to static designs.
